我正在尝试更改Word文档中的背景颜色(仅限几个单词)。
我正在使用DocX(https://docx.codeplex.com/SourceControl/latest#Examples/Program.cs),但我找不到允许我这样做的任何方法/属性。
这是我的代码:
var rb = new Formatting();
rb.UnderlineColor = this.GetResultColor(stu.RespectfulBehavior);
rb.FontColor = this.GetResultColor(stu.RespectfulBehavior);
templ.ReplaceText(PlaceHolders.RespectfulBehaviour.GetDisplayName(), " ", newFormatting: rb);
请帮忙,谢谢
答案 0 :(得分:0)
查看课程中Formatting的DocX源代码,我会说您正在寻找Highlight
。所以如果你想要用蓝色突出显示的东西
rb.Highlight = Highlight.blue;
修改强> 这似乎已经在这个问题https://stackoverflow.com/a/30141775/2039359
中得到了解答